When it comes to creating cute male drawings, it’s important to start with a solid base. A good base provides the foundation for your character and helps you maintain proper proportions. Begin by sketching simple shapes like circles and ovals to outline the head, body, and limbs. This will give you a basic framework to build upon.

To add cuteness to your male characters, focus on emphasizing round features such as soft cheeks, chubby hands, and slightly larger eyes. Play around with different hairstyles and expressions to give each character their own unique personality and charm.

When it comes to drawing male characters, having a variety of cute drawing bases can be incredibly helpful. By using different types of bases as a starting point, you can easily create charming and appealing male characters in your artwork. Let’s explore some popular options:

  1. Chibi Bases: Chibi style is known for its adorable and exaggerated features, making it perfect for creating cute male characters. Chibi bases typically have large heads, big eyes, and small bodies with simplified proportions. They are great for capturing the essence of innocence and charm in your drawings.
  2. Anime Bases: Anime-style drawing bases offer a wide range of possibilities when it comes to portraying male cuteness. These bases often focus on expressive eyes, soft facial features, and stylish hairstyles that enhance the appeal of your character. You can experiment with different anime base poses and expressions to bring out the desired cuteness factor.
  3. Animal-inspired Bases: Adding animal characteristics to your male character can instantly make them more adorable. Animal-inspired drawing bases allow you to incorporate elements like animal ears or tails into your artwork, giving your character a unique charm that appeals to viewers.
  4. Super deformed (SD) Bases: Super deformed bases take cuteness to another level by exaggerating the proportions even further than chibi style drawings. With oversized heads, tiny bodies, and minimalistic details, SD bases create an irresistibly cute look for male characters.
  5. Emotion-based Bases: Emotion-based drawing bases provide a fantastic way to depict various moods while maintaining the cute factor in your artwork. Whether it’s a shy smile or an excited expression, these bases help convey specific emotions through facial features and body language.
  6. Play with Proportions: Experiment with different proportions to achieve different looks and styles for your male characters. For a cute and chibi-like appearance, consider exaggerating certain features such as larger heads or bigger eyes. Remember that proportion is key in creating visually appealing characters.
  7. Add Unique Details: To make your male drawings stand out, focus on adding unique details that reflect their individuality or specific traits. Think about factors like hairstyle, clothing style, accessories, or any distinctive characteristics that contribute to their overall charm.
